Dental Support Services is the 82nd most popular major in the country with 26,399 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, dental support services gra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$35,442 and had an average of $15,159 in loans still to pay off.
Across New York, there were 799 dental support services graduates with average earnings and debt of $43,576 and $14,601 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 0 dental support services graduates with average earnings and debt of $61,893 and $0 respectively.
